Concordia University Chicago’s premier choral performance ensemble, the Kapelle, will set out for its spring 2026 tour February 27–March 6, presenting a deeply meaningful program titled “Enduring with Jesus: Songs of Faith and Hope.” This tour brings the ensemble to congregations and schools across Florida, culminating in a home concert on Sunday, March 15 at 4 p.m. in the Chapel of Our Lord on Concordia-Chicago’s River Forest campus. Admission is free and free, handicapped-accessible parking is available in the University’s parking structure on Bonnie Brae.
Inspired by the University’s academic year theme, Rejoicing in a Living Hope (1 Peter 1:3–4), the program offers a musical journey that evokes feelings of tribulation, perseverance, and the comfort that only can be found in Christ. Repertoire spans centuries and styles—from Johann Sebastian Bach and Felix Mendelssohn-Bartholdy to Hugo Distler, Richard Hillert, and Thomas Gieschen—reflecting the Christian’s walk with a Savior who bears the sins of His people and brings them hope, a reality brought into sharper focus during Lent.
The Kapelle will also perform Conductor Dr. Charles P. Brown’s version of the traditional children’s hymn “God Loves Me Dearly” during their spring performances. Brown, who is a professor of music and chair of Concordia-Chicago’s Arts division, is a distinguished choral conductor, educator, and clinician whose work includes festival leadership, scholarly presentations, and many other contributions to music education and Lutheran church music.
